Functional equivalence of Hox gene products in the specification of the tritocerebrum during embryonic brain development of Drosophila.
Development (Cambridge, England) - 1 Dec 2001
Hirth F, Loop T, Egger B, Miller D F, Kaufman T C, Reichert H
Abstract excerpt
Hox genes encode evolutionarily conserved transcription factors involved in the specification of segmental identity during embryonic development. This specification of identity is thought to be directed by differential Hox gene action, based on differential spatiotemporal expression patterns, protein sequence differences, interactions with co-factors and regulation of specific downstream genes.
